A student-initiated and student-run community service program called the Healthy Neighborhoods Project (HNP) hosted the first Healthy Neighborhoods Celebration health fair since 2002.
On Sunday, October 8, the HNP sponsored a community-focused health fair at SACHS–Norton on East 3rd Street in San Bernardino.
The community was invited to take part in screenings and awareness exhibi- tions on breast and skin cancer, dia- betes, immunizations, obesity, dental health, and child safety, among others.
The health professional students at LLU have a long-standing involvement in the Norton Neighborhoods, a largely uninsured and medically underserved population in San Bernardino.
The health fair initially began in 2001 as part of a “Caring for Communi- ties” grant by Pfizer/AMA that two med- ical students received to begin the Community Kids Connection
tutoring/mentoring program. The health fair and a race were supposed to be the fundraiser to keep the
tutoring/mentoring program going. The health fair and race continued for two years, then in 2003, the event was can- celled due to the fires that ravaged the Inland Empire.
This year, under the direction of Leslie Hsu, a fourth-year medical stu- dent and the health fair director, and with sponsorship from LLUMC–East Campus’s PossAbilities program and the Inland Empire Health Plan, the health fair was resurrected with many student
booths and community booths for edu- cational purposes for the San
Bernardino community.
Besides the health fair, the men- toring and academic tutoring programs that are part of the Healthy Neighbor- hoods Project give LLU students the opportunity to form ongoing friendships with local children and parents.
The mentoring programs are stu- dent-initiated and student-run and are based in the School of Medicine.
Beginning in July 2007, the LLU School of Allied Health Professions department of occupational therapy will launch its online doctoral program.
The online degree program received accreditation in December 2006 from the Western Association for Schools and Colleges.
“The flexibility of our online pro- gram is designed to fit the busy lives of working occupational therapists,” according to Heather Javaherian, OTD, OTR/L, assistant professor and director of the occupational therapy doctoral pro- gram, “helping to meet the ever-changing technological demands of society.”
The coursework includes an emphasis on spirituality, diversity, critical reasoning, advocacy, participation, edu- cation, and independent research, says Dr. Javaherian.
Graduates from the program will be prepared to enter academia; conduct research; develop, implement, and assess innovative programs; influence public policy, and experience personal as well as professional growth in the spirit of Loma Linda University.
“Our online community will foster learning and professional growth,” Dr. Javaherian continues, “through creative learning experiences, critical reflections,
community, and in-depth discussions.” The program’s capstone is a 16-unit professional rotation designed by the individual students and approved by the doctoral committee.
“Our faculty envisions the rotation,” Dr. Javaherian explains, “as a way of allowing students to express their cre- ativity, explore new areas of practice, and engage in innovative research and com- munity program development.”
